[英]Sql query from related tables
我有3張桌子:
購物:
id buyer fruit
1 1 [->] 2 [->]
2 2 [->] 2 [->]
水果:
id fruit
1 apple
2 banana
買家:
id buyer
1 ido
2 omri
我想從'shopping'表中提取並將其他表的值放在行中。 例如:'shopping'中的第一行應如下所示:
id buyer fruit
1 ido banana
您只需要在各自的ID上加入相關表:
SELECT s.id, b.buyer, f.fruit
FROM shopping s
JOIN fruits f ON s.fruit = f.id
JOIN buyers b ON s.buyer = b.id
聲明:本站的技術帖子網頁,遵循CC BY-SA 4.0協議,如果您需要轉載,請注明本站網址或者原文地址。任何問題請咨詢:yoyou2525@163.com.